STOCKTON – Representative Josh Harder (CA-9) is demanding the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) fix their massive mistake of leaving San Joaquin County grape growers out of the Grapevine crop insurance program. Without being able to participate in this crucial program, Lodi grape growers’ livelihoods are put at risk.

WASHINGTON – Today, ahead of the 25th National Prescription Drug Take Back Day on Saturday, Rep. Josh Harder (CA-9) is encouraging families to find their nearest take-back site and make a plan to safely dispose of unneeded medications. Between 10 AM and 2 PM on Saturday, most police stations in San Joaquin County will be accepting unneeded prescription drugs, no questions asked.
